Come and get hands-on volunteering at Sydney City Farm.

This is a great opportunity to get involved with Sydney City Farm and meet others in your community.

New volunteers are required to attend a mandatory induction prior to joining one of our regular volunteer sessions. Once you've learnt the essentials, you're eligible to attend our regular volunteer sessions and can get involved as often as you like. Before volunteering you also need to fill in the volunteer registration form.

Volunteer sessions last for 2 hours and are held on Thursdays, Fridays and every second Saturday.

  • Thursday mornings are spent working on general farm activities in our cropping area. From watering and weeding to planting and harvesting, these sessions are great for new volunteers to get a taste for volunteering at the farm.

  • Friday mornings involve working in the plant nursery and depot area. Tasks include raising seedlings, collecting and processing seed, and caring for our small potted fruit trees. These sessions suit volunteers who want to develop plant propagation and nursery skills.

  • Saturdays are for project work in the farm’s orchard, floriculture, agroforestry demonstration garden beds, and edible display gardens like the mini fruit forest and agricultural crops.

Bookings are essential. No group bookings. For corporate volunteer enquiries please contact us at cityfarm@cityofsydney.nsw.gov.au

Please wear clothes that can get dirty and covered sturdy shoes. Bring a hat, gardening gloves and water bottle.

Volunteer sessions will not proceed in wet, extreme or dangerous weather.
